Top Local Places

Leids Universitair Medisch Centrum

Albinusdreef 2, Leiden, Netherlands
Local business

Description

ad

Leids Universitair Medisch Centrum (LUMC)

Quiz

NEAR Leids Universitair Medisch Centrum